Really random, but does anyone remember Rigetti's 128 qubit computer chip that was supposed to be released in 2019? What happened to it? Has it been released or is it delayed, maybe cancelled? Can't find anything online. "We have in the past failed to meet publicly announced milestones and may fail to meet projected technological milestones in the future. For example, in 2018, we announced that we planned to build and deploy a 128-qubit system over the subsequent twelve months, but have not to date built a 128-qubit system." https://www.sec.gov/Archives/edgar/data/1838359/000119312522113117/d200128ds1a.htm Ankaa-3 is doing pretty well but this deploys a 100-qubit chip that they test on in isolation and with arrays instead of the full chip capacity I think Theres also a shift in the paradigm happening at the moment away from NISQ. First rule of modern capitalism: overpromise, underdeliver. Rigetti just couldn't deliver on the 128 qubit timeline and never publicly addressed it. They set the goal in 2018 and missed it without much explanation. The industry's moved away from chasing high qubit counts anyway. Error rates matter more than raw numbers, so companies like Rigetti shifted focus to building smaller, more reliable systems. That is why their recent Ankaa work uses 100 qubits but tests them in isolation instead of maxing out capacity. right- I see.
